    I had written a similar thread last year when they won the World Championships. Note that they won it on 19th August 2007, while they won the Olympics Gold Medal on 16th August 2008!

    Here's what our BC forumer ye333 wrote about them for the outlook of 2008:
    08奥运,夺冠概率我认为马亨最大,古陈风云钟李差不多。其他组合碰上这几对的任何一对都是下风球,但是想 夺冠至少要灭其中两个,因此没有什么希望。从过往奥运看,男双冠军都是实至名归(92朴/金,96苏/迈,00陈/吴,04金/河),从无意外出现。

    My translation:
    I personally think that the chance of Kido/Hendra winning the Gold in the Olympics is the highest (that's a real compliment coming from a Chinese). Other pairs will be at a disadvantage when they meet these 4 pairs, since they would have to beat at least two of them to have any chance of a medal, so, not much hope for them. From the previous Olympics, the Gold-Medallists usually are worthy winners (92: Park/Kim; 96: Ricky/Rexy; 00: Tony/Candra; 04: Ha/Kim); there are usually no surprise winners :cool:

    Honestly, once you know how to play against Fu Haifeng/Cai Yun, they will crumble naturally. In the last 2 matches that the INA pair beat Fu/Cai (ignore the first set of the FINAL), the scores were ridiculously "not tight":
    Hong Kong Open SEMI-FINAL: 21-15, 21-12
    Beijing Olympics FINAL: 11-21, 21-12, 21-16.

    BUT, things might be different if they face Jung Jae Sung/Lee Yong Dae. Lee Yong Dae's brilliance at the net is something that even Hendra Setiawan struggled to match in recent matches :eek::cool:

    I will look forward to their next encounter. Hopefully, Kido/Hendra can beat Jung/Lee next time!

    MK / HS: The Badminton Mens Doubles Olympic Champions @ Beijing 2008

    .
    I was predicting JJS / LYD (KOR) to win the Mens Doubles Gold medals. But when JJS / LYD was defeated by LP / JR (DEN), and MK / HS defeated LP / JR 21/19, 21/17 in the Semi-Finals, I guessed that MK / HS could win the GOLD.

    Congratulations to MK / HS for becoming the Badminton Mens Doubles Olympic Champions @ Beijing 2008 !!!
